Railroad Settlement Asthma: Understanding the Impact and Seeking Justice
Railroad workers are important to the smooth functioning of transportation networks across North America. Nevertheless, their occupation exposes them to a myriad of occupational risks, including the risk of developing breathing conditions such as asthma. Railroad Settlement Copd workers are entitled to settlement for injuries and health problems sustained due to their job. Workers experiencing railroad settlement asthma may pursue legal action under the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A), which supplies a structure for employees to look for damages for injuries triggered by negligence. The following are the common actions included:

Documentation of Injury: Collect thorough medical records and documents that support the asthma diagnosis and link it to work-related exposures.

Notify Employer: Inform the employer about the asthma condition and its potential relation to work settings to initiate an internal investigation.

Consult an Attorney: Seek legal recommendations from a lawyer experienced in FELA claims and occupational hazards.

Suing: If wanted, submit a formal claim against the railroad business, providing evidence of negligence or unsafe working conditions.

Settlement Negotiation: Enter negotiations with the railroad business for a settlement that covers medical expenditures, lost incomes, and future care.

Pursue Court Action: If a satisfying settlement can not be reached, the complaintant has the option to take the case to court.
Assistance Systems for Asthma Patients
For individuals affected by railroad settlement asthma, a number of support group help with medical diagnosis and treatment. These consist of:

Occupational Health Services: Railroad business typically supply access to occupational health clinics specializing in diagnosing and handling job-related illnesses.

Pulmonary Rehabilitation Programs: These programs assist patients enhance their lung health through exercise and education on asthma management strategies.

Medication: Prescription medications, such as inhalers and corticosteroids, can substantially alleviate asthma signs and enhance quality of life.

Support system: Joining local or online asthma support system can offer emotional assistance and shared experiences for those dealing with similar challenges.
